Table 2 lists the system architecture specifications for the SAN64B-6 switch.
Table 2 System architecture
Feature Description
Product number 8960-F64 (Front/Port-Side Exhaust).
8960-N64 (Rear/Non-Port Side Exhaust).
Fibre Channel ports Switch mode (default): Minimum of 24 ports and maximum of 64 ports
configuration. Port numbers above minimum are enabled through 12-port
SFP+ increments with Ports on Demand (PoD) licenses, and through one
4-port QSFP PoD, providing 16-port increments through a Q-Flex license:
E_Ports, F_Ports, D_Ports, and EX_Ports.
Access Gateway default port mapping: 40 SFP+ F_Ports, 8 SFP+ N_Ports.
Scalability Full-fabric architecture with a maximum of 239 switches.
Certified maximum 6,000 active nodes; 56 switches, 19 hops in Fabric OS fabrics; larger fabrics
certified as required.
Fibre Channel
performance
4.25 Gbps line speed, full duplex.
8.5 Gbps line speed, full duplex.
10.53 Gbps line speed, full duplex.
14.025 Gbps line speed, full duplex.
28.05 Gbps, full duplex.
Auto-sensing of 4, 8, 16, 32 Gbps port speeds and capable of supporting
128 Gbps speeds.
10 Gbps optionally programmable to fixed port speed.
ISL trunking Frame-based trunking with up to eight 32 Gbps ports per ISL trunk; up to 256
Gbps per ISL trunk.
Exchange-based load balancing across ISLs with DPS included in Fabric OS.
Aggregate
bandwidth
2 Tbps.
Maximum fabric
latency
Latency for locally switched ports is 700 ns; encryption/compression is 1 µsec
per node.
Maximum frame
size
2,112-byte payload.
Frame buffers 15,360 dynamically allocated.
Classes of service Class 2, Class 3, Class F (inter-switch frames).
Port types D_Port (ClearLink Diagnostic Port), E_Port, EX_Port, F_Port, AE_Port
optional port-type control.
b-type Access Gateway mode: F_Port and NPIV-enabled N_Port.
Data traffic types Fabric switches supporting unicast.
Hot-swap
components
Power supplies, fan modules, SFPs.
Warranty One-year; customer-replaceable unit (CRU); and onsite, next-business-day
response; warranty service upgrades are available.
